Defense Wins the Day in Maryville’s 0-0 Draw with McKendree

ST. LOUIS – Maryville men's soccer draws with McKendree University 0-0 on a windy Friday afternoon. The Saints are now 7-1-3 overall in 2023 and 4-1-2 in the Great Lakes Valley Conference.
 
Run of Play:
  • Nick Hemann made his first save of the game at 15:37 when Olle Ridelius put a low shot on goal.
  • Gabe Hallsten had a good scoring chance in the 24th minute but he was blocked by a Maryville defender.
  • McKendree outshot the Saints six to one in the first half, forcing Hemann to make two saves.
  • Rhys Davies tested Hemann again early in the second half, but he turned away a low shot for his third.
  • Maryville put their only shot on goal of the game when Mason Crew tried to win the game at 89:46, but he was denied by Christian Herluf.
 
Game Notes: 
  • Maryville and McKendree have tied in their last three matchups. Additionally, the Saints have not lost to the Bearcats since Oct. 14, 2018.
  • Nick Hemann logged his third shutout of the season and his second consecutive. His last goal surrendered was at 63:14 on Sept. 29, against William Jewell.
